High-Calorie Food Options for Backcountry Hunting

When planning meals for a backcountry hunt, it’s crucial to focus on high-calorie foods that are lightweight and compact. Jerky, either beef, turkey, or venison, is an excellent source of protein and calories. A single ounce of beef jerky contains about 70-80 calories, making it a convenient and energy-dense food option.

Meal Planning Strategies for High-Calorie Foods

To incorporate high-calorie foods into your meal plan, consider the following strategies: (1) Dehydrated meals: Look for freeze-dried meals that are high in calories and protein, such as Mountain House or Backpacker’s Pantry. These meals can be rehydrated with hot water and provide a significant energy boost. (2) Trail mix: Mix high-calorie foods like nuts, seeds, and dried fruits to create a trail mix that is both tasty and filling. Aim for a mix that contains a balance of carbohydrates, protein, and healthy fats. (3) High-calorie snacks: In addition to jerky and trail mix, consider other high-calorie snack options like Clif Bars, energy chews, or dried fruit leather.
